Sewer Scope Service in Rockville, MD
Sewer scope services involve the use of specialized cameras to inspect the interior condition of a property's sewer line. This process helps identify issues such as blockages, pipe cracks, root intrusions, or other damage that may not be visible from the surface. These inspections are often requested during home inspections before purchasing a property, to evaluate the condition of existing sewer lines, or when experiencing persistent drainage problems. Property owners typically want to understand the current state of their sewer system and determine if repairs or replacements are necessary to prevent future backups or costly damages.
Before requesting a sewer scope, property owners should consider what specific concerns they have about their sewer system, such as recurring clogs or foul odors. It’s also useful to know the age of the sewer pipes and any history of repairs or previous issues. This information helps determine whether a comprehensive inspection is appropriate and what potential next steps might be. Sewer scope services provide valuable insights that assist homeowners in making informed decisions about maintenance, repairs, or upgrades to ensure the sewer system functions properly.

Common Sewer Scope Service Jobs
Drain line inspections - identify blockages, cracks, or collapses in sewer pipes.
Pre-purchase sewer evaluations - assess the condition of sewer lines before buying a property.
Troubleshooting sewer backups - locate the source of recurring clogs or backups in the sewer system.
Pipe condition assessments - detect corrosion, root intrusion, or deterioration in underground pipes.
Sewer line repairs planning - gather detailed visuals to determine the best repair or replacement options.
Preventive sewer checks - monitor pipe health to avoid costly future repairs or emergencies.
Sewer Scope Service Questions
What is a sewer scope service? It involves inspecting the interior of a sewer line using a specialized camera to identify issues such as blockages, cracks, or root intrusion.
When should property owners consider a sewer scope? A sewer scope is recommended before purchasing a property, when experiencing persistent drain backups, or if there are signs of sewer line problems.
How does a sewer scope help in property maintenance? It provides a clear view of the sewer line’s condition, helping to detect issues early and plan necessary repairs or replacements.
What types of projects typically require a sewer scope service? Sewer scopes are often used during home inspections, post-repair assessments, or when upgrading plumbing systems to ensure line integrity.
